In the book of Daniel there is a story of 3 Hebrew Gentlemen by the names of Shadrack, Meshach, and Abednego that against the degree of King Nebuchadnezzar would not bow down to a golden graven image. Neuchadnezzar threw the Hebrew Men into the furnace but instead of being burned alive the God of Abraham, Issac, and Jacob stood in the flame without a burn. The moral of the story is faith, devotion, and steadfastness.

“Our God whom we serve is able to deliver us from the burning, fiery furnace; and he will deliver us out of thine hand, O king. But if not, be it known unto thee, O king, that we will not serve thy gods, nor worship the golden image which thou hast set up.” Daniel 3:17–18
